Transaction 59b0982cb33e276b5448745209c892394a2c2095bec82e9965b03c545828038e
1 Input
1 Output
-
59b0982cb33e276b5448745209c892394a2c2095bec82e9965b03c545828038e:0
- value
- 2800000
- script pubkey
- OP_0 OP_PUSHBYTES_20 3abb66dbe84c7e0181933aee262f1e7c3ee4dc4f
- address
- bc1q82akdklgf3lqrqvn8thzvtc70slwfhz0m39mmh